Event Description
It was reported that the arctic sun device was alerting air leak and no flow.They changed to a second device (serial (b)(4)) and with new set of arctic gel pads.During therapy on the first device (serial (b)(4)) all lines were straight with no bends or kinks, 4 arctic gel pads were connected, fluid delivery line (fdl) was secure and intact, and device had good airflow to back.Nurse was alerting low air leak and no flow.Nurse changed to a new set of pads.Other pads were new as well.System diagnostics showed that outlet monitor temperature (t1) was 11.3c, outlet control temperature (t2) was 11.2c, inlet temperature (t3) was 22.6c, chiller temperature (t4) was 4.1c, water flow rate was 0lpm, inlet pressure was -1.2 psi, circulation pump command was 100 percent, mixing pump command was 100 percent, heater command was 0 percent, water reservoir level was 4 bars, system hours were 10365.1 and pump hours were 9725.3.During therapy on the second device (serial (b)(4)) all lines were straight with no bends or kinks, 4 arctic gel pads connected, fluid delivery line (fdl) was secure and intact, and device had good airflow to back.The device was alerting low air leak and no flow (serial (b)(4)) with the new set of pads.Both sets of new pads gave same alerts on this device as well.In manual control at 30c system diagnostics showed that outlet monitor temperature (t1) was 17.4c, outlet control temperature (t2) was 17.2c, inlet temperature (t3) was 17c, chiller temperature (t4) was 5.5c, water flow rate was 1.6lpm, inlet pressure was -1.1psi, circulation pump command was 100 percent, mixing pump command was 100 percent, heater command was 0 percent, water reservoir level was 3 bars, system hours were 11158.8 and pump hours were 10630.4.The 3rd device was hooked up to same new pads.The device primed and leveled out with flow rate was 3.4lpm.Flow rate was maintained for a couple of minutes before disconnecting with caller.Mss advised to send 1st two devices to biomed and call with any questions.Per follow up information received on 22sep2022, nurse stated there were no patient injuries and patient was able to continue therapy on different device.Per sample evaluation results received on 08nov2022 for the first device with serial# (b)(4), it was reported that the neutral side connection between the power inlet module and the ac main voltage circuit card shows signs of electrical overstress.Tank seals were frayed.During pump servicing both circulation pump motor and mixing pump motor had cracked thread housings that hold the pump bolts in place.The double bend tube and the chiller evaporator outlet tube were found expanded during servicing.Tank seals were found lifted from the tank.The chiller pump molded tube was replaced due to the old one tearing while removing the tank for seal replacement.Per sample evaluation results received on 08nov2022 for the second device with serial# (b)(4), replacement of double bend tube and the chiller evaporator outlet tube due to expansion of the tubes found during servicing.Replacement of the tank seals due to lifting from the tank.Replaced the outer shell due to a sheared off retaining bolt and the power cord due to frayed end.The root cause of the reported issue was due to a weak circulation pump.

Manufacturer Narrative
The reported issue was confirmed.The reported issue was confirmed, however the root cause was not able to be isolated.A potential root cause could be due to stress- or impact-induced fracturing or weakening of internal components.The device was evaluated and the reported issue was confirmed as it was noted that the circulation pump motor had cracked thread housings that hold the pump bolts in place.Replaced circulation pump motor.Completed the 2000-hour pm procedure on the device.Serviced the circulation pump and mixing pump replaced heater lot 1422 with lot 2151, and replaced both manifold o-rings and drain valves.He device was put through a functional check.The device was heated to 42°c and cooled to 4°c and was stable at 28°c with a flow of 1.8 l/m with -7.0 psi in bypass mode.The device was placed on acats (automated calibration and test system).An electrical safety test was performed.A final inspection was performed.The arctic sun 5000 passed all performance testing, calibration and electrical safety tests and is functioning properly and ready for use.The dhr is not required as the reported event is not an out of box failure and therefore the reported event is not manufacturing related.Based on the results of the investigation, no additional actions are needed.The instructions for use were found adequate and state the following: "the arctic sun® temperature management system is intended for monitoring and controlling patient temperature.Warnings and cautions.Warnings: do not use the arctic sun® temperature management system in the presence of flammable agents because an explosion and/or fire may result.Do not use high frequency surgical instruments or endocardial catheters while the arctic sun® temperature management system is in use.There is a risk of electrical shock and hazardous moving parts.There are no user serviceable parts inside.Do not remove covers.Refer servicing to qualified personnel.Power cord has a hospital grade plug.Grounding reliability can only be achieved when connected to an equivalent receptacle marked ¿hospital use¿ or ¿hospital grade¿.When using the arctic sun® temperature management system, note that all other thermal conductive systems, such as water blankets and water gels, in use while warming or cooling with the arctic sun® temperature management system may actually alter or interfere with patient temperature control.Do not place arcticgel¿ pads over transdermal medication patches as warming can increase drug delivery, resulting in possible harm to the patient.The arctic sun® temperature management system is not intended for use in the operating room environment.Cautions: this product is to be used by or under the supervision of trained, qualified medical personnel.Federal law (usa) restricts this device to sale, by or on the order of a physician.Use only sterile water.The use of other fluids will damage the arctic sun® temperature management system.When moving the arctic sun® temperature management system always use the handle to lift the controller over an obstacle to avoid over balancing.The patient¿s bed surface should be located between 30 and 60 inches (75 cm and 150 cm) above the floor to ensure proper flow and minimize risk of leaks.The clinician is responsible to determine the appropriateness of custom parameters.When the system is powered off, all changes to parameters will revert to the default unless the new settings have been saved as new defaults in the advanced setup screen.For small patients (=30 kg) it is recommended to use the following settings: water temperature high limit =40°c (104°f); water temperature low limit =10°c (50°f); control strategy = 2.It is recommended to use the patient temperature high and patient temperature low alert settings.The operator must continuously monitor patient temperature when using manual control and adjust the temperature of the water flowing through the pads accordingly.Patient temperature will not be controlled by the arctic sun® temperature management system in manual control.Due to the system¿s high efficiency, manual control is not recommended for long duration use.The operator is advised to use the automatic therapy modes (e.G.Control patient, cool patient, rewarm patient) for automatic patient temperature monitoring and control.The arctic sun® temperature management system will monitor and control patient core temperature based on the temperature probe attached to the system.The clinician is responsible for correctly placing the temperature probe and verifying the accuracy and placement of the patient probe at the start of the procedure.Medivance supplies temperature simulators (fixed value resistors) for testing, training and demonstration purposes.Never use this device, or other method, to circumvent the normal patient temperature feedback control when the system is connected to the patient.Doing so exposes the patient to the hazards associated with severe hypo- or hyper thermia.Medivance recommends measuring patient temperature from a second site to verify patient temperature.Medivance recommends the use of a second patient temperature probe connected to the arctic sun® temperature management system temperature 2 input as it provides continuous monitoring and safety alarm features.Alternatively, patient temperature may be verified periodically with independent instrumentation.The displayed temperature graph is for general information purposes only and is not intended to replace standard medical record documentation for use in therapy decisions.Patient temperature will not be controlled and alarms are not enabled in stop mode.Patient temperature may increase or decrease with the arctic sun® temperature management system in stop mode.Carefully observe the system for air leaks before and during use.If the pads fail to prime or a significant continuous air leak is observed in the pad return line, check connections.If needed, replace the leaking pad.Leakage may result in lower flow rates and potentially decrease the performance of the system.The arctic sun® temperature management system is for use only with the arcticgel¿ pads.The arcticgel¿ pads are only for use with the arctic sun® temperature management systems.The arcticgel¿ pads are non-sterile for single patient use.Do not reprocess or sterilize.If used in a sterile environment, pads should be placed according to the physician¿s request, either prior to the sterile preparation or sterile draping.Arcticgel¿ pads should not be placed on a sterile field.Use pads immediately after opening.Do not store pads once the kit has been opened.Do not place arcticgel¿ pads on skin that has signs of ulceration, burns, hives, or rash.While there are no known allergies to hydrogel materials, caution should be exercised with any patient who has a history of skin allergies or sensitivities.Do not allow circulating water to contaminate the sterile field when patient lines are disconnected.The water content of the hydrogel affects the pad¿s adhesion to the skin and conductivity, and therefore, the efficiency of controlling patient temperature.Periodically check that pads remain moist and adherent.Replace pads when the hydrogel no longer uniformly adheres to the skin.Replacing pads at least every 5 days is recommended.Do not puncture the arcticgel¿ pads with sharp objects.Punctures will result in air entering the fluid pathway and may reduce performance.If accessible, examine the patient¿s skin under the arcticgel¿ pads often, especially those at higher risk of skin injury.Skin injury may occur as a cumulative result of pressure, time and temperature.Possible skin injuries include bruising, tearing, skin ulcerations, blistering, and necrosis.Do not place bean bag or other firm positioning devices under the arcticgel¿ pads.Do not place positioning devices under the pad manifolds or patient lines.The rate of temperature change and potentially the final achievable patient temperature is affected by many factors.Treatment application, monitoring and results are the responsibility of the attending physician.If the patient does not reach target temperature in a reasonable time or the patient is not able to be maintained at the target temperature, the skin may be exposed to low or high water temperatures for an extended period of time which may increase the risk for skin injury.Ensure that pad sizing/ coverage and custom parameter settings are correct for the patient and treatment goals, water flow is greater than or equal to 2.3 liters per minute and the patient temperature probe is in the correct place.For patient cooling, ensure environmental factors such as excessively hot rooms, heat lamps, and heated nebulizers are eliminated and patient shivering is controlled.Otherwise, consider increasing minimum water temperature, modifying target temperature to an attainable setting or discontinuing treatment.For patient warming, consider decreasing maximum water temperature, modifying target temperature to an attainable setting or discontinuing treatment.Due to underlying medical or physiological conditions, some patients are more susceptible to skin damage from pressure and heat or cold.Patients at risk include those with poor tissue perfusion or poor skin integrity due to diabetes, peripheral vascular disease, poor nutritional status, steroid use or high dose vasopressor therapy.If warranted, use pressure relieving or pressure reducing devices under the patient to protect from skin injury.Do not allow urine, antibacterial solutions or other agents to pool underneath the arcticgel¿ pads.Urine and antibacterial agents can absorb into the pad hydrogel and cause chemical injury and loss of pad adhesion.Replace pads immediately if these fluids come into contact with the hydrogel.Do not place arcticgel¿ pads over an electrosurgical grounding pad.The combination of heat sources may result in skin burns.If needed, place defibrillation pads between the arcticgel¿ pads and the patient¿s skin.Carefully remove arcticgel¿ pads from the patient¿s skin at the completion of use.Discard used arcticgel¿ pads in accordance with hospital procedures for medical waste.The usb data port is to be used only with a standalone usb flash drive.Do not connect to another mains powered device during patient treatment.Users should not use cleaning or decontamination methods different from those recommended by the manufacturer without first checking with the manufacturer that the proposed methods will not damage the equipment.Do not use bleach (sodium hypochlorite) as it may damage the system.Medivance will not be responsible for patient safety or equipment performance if the procedures to operate, maintain, modify or service the medivance arctic sun® temperature management system are other than those specified by medivance.Anyone performing the procedures must be appropriately trained
